Lyndal Carter is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Speech and Hearing and Sensory Systems. According to data from OpenAlex, Lyndal Carter has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 664 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 14 papers in Speech and Hearing and 11 papers in Sensory Systems. Recurrent topics in Lyndal Carter’s work include Hearing Loss and Rehabilitation (22 papers), Noise Effects and Management (14 papers) and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(11 papers). Lyndal Carter is often cited by papers focused on Hearing Loss and Rehabilitation (22 papers), Noise Effects and Management (14 papers) and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(11 papers). Lyndal Carter collaborates with scholars based in Australia, Germany and Taiwan. Lyndal Carter's co-authors include Harvey Dillon, Gitte Keidser, Warwick Williams, Bram Van Dun and John P. Seymour and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of the Acoustical Society of America, Ear and Hearing and International Journal of Audiology.
